Understanding the Core Mechanics and Risk Factors
At its heart, the crash game operates on a provably fair system, meaning the outcome of each round is determined by a cryptographic hash that is publicly verifiable. This transparency eliminates any suspicion of manipulation, assuring players that the game is genuinely random. However, ‘random’ doesn’t equal ‘predictable.’ While you can’t foresee when the crash will occur, understanding the underlying principles guiding its behavior is essential. The random number generator (RNG) is the engine of the game, and while it's unpredictable, comprehending its basic function informs your strategic approach. Each round is independent; past results have absolutely no influence on future outcomes. This is a crucial concept to grasp – avoid falling into the trap of believing in ‘hot’ or ‘cold’ streaks. They are purely the result of chance.
The central risk factor is, of course, the crash itself. The multiplier can climb indefinitely, potentially offering huge returns, but it could crash at any moment, even at 1.01x. This inherent uncertainty demands a careful risk-reward assessment. The longer you wait to cash out, the greater the potential payout, but also the higher the risk of losing your entire stake. Many players adopt a strategy of setting a target multiplier and automatically cashing out when that target is reached. Others prefer manual cashing out, relying on their intuition and observation of the multiplier’s behavior. Both approaches have their merits and drawbacks, and the best strategy ultimately depends on your individual risk tolerance and playing style. It is also important to understand the ‘house edge’ inherent in the game, which represents the casino's profit margin over time.

Effective Bankroll Management Strategies
Successful crash game play isn’t solely about predicting when the multiplier will crash; it's heavily reliant on responsible bankroll management. Treat your starting funds as capital – something that needs to be protected and grown, not recklessly gambled away. A common and effective strategy is to allocate a specific percentage of your bankroll to each round. A conservative approach might involve risking only 1-2% of your total bankroll on each bet. This minimizes the impact of losing streaks and allows you to weather periods of bad luck. Conversely, a more aggressive strategy might involve risking 5-10%, but this requires a larger bankroll and a higher risk tolerance. It is vital to avoid chasing losses – increasing your stake after a loss in an attempt to quickly recover your funds is a recipe for disaster.
Another important concept is setting win and loss limits. Before you start playing, decide how much you are willing to win or lose in a single session. Once you reach either limit, stop playing. This prevents emotional decision-making and helps you maintain discipline. Furthermore, consider using a betting progression system, such as the Martingale or Anti-Martingale. The Martingale involves doubling your stake after each loss, aiming to recover your previous losses with a single win. However, this strategy can quickly deplete your bankroll if you encounter a prolonged losing streak. The Anti-Martingale, on the other hand, involves increasing your stake after each win, capitalizing on winning streaks. It's crucial to understand the risks associated with each progression system and to choose one that aligns with your risk tolerance.

Strategies for Cash-Out Points: Manual vs. Auto Cash-Out
Choosing the right cash-out strategy is paramount. There are two primary approaches: manual cash-out and auto cash-out. Manual cash-out involves actively monitoring the multiplier and clicking the ‘cash out’ button at the precise moment you desire. This requires quick reflexes, concentration, and a degree of intuition. Experienced players often use manual cash-out to capitalize on seemingly favorable multiplier patterns or to react to subtle changes in the game's behavior. However, it's also prone to errors – a momentary lapse in concentration or a slow internet connection could result in missing your target multiplier and losing your stake. The psychological pressure can also be significant, potentially leading to hasty or irrational decisions.
Auto cash-out, on the other hand, allows you to pre-set a target multiplier. The game will automatically cash out your bet when the multiplier reaches that level. This eliminates the risk of human error and provides a more relaxed playing experience. It's a particularly useful strategy for players who prefer a more passive approach or who are prone to impulsive decisions. However, auto cash-out can also be inflexible. If the multiplier quickly reaches and falls just short of your target, you'll miss out on a potential profit. Therefore, carefully consider your target multiplier based on your risk tolerance and the current game conditions. It’s often beneficial to test different auto cash-out values to determine what consistently produces profitable results for your style.

The Psychology of Crash Gambling: Avoiding Common Pitfalls
The crash game is as much a psychological battle as it is a game of chance. The allure of potentially massive payouts can easily lead to emotional decision-making, which often results in losses. One common pitfall is the ‘gambler’s fallacy’ – the belief that past events influence future outcomes. As previously mentioned, each round is entirely independent, and past results have no bearing on the next one. Another common mistake is letting greed cloud your judgment. Seeing the multiplier steadily climb can create a temptation to wait for an even higher payout, but this increases your risk exponentially. Sticking to your pre-determined cash-out point, regardless of how tempting it is to wait longer, is crucial.
Fear also plays a significant role. The fear of losing can lead to prematurely cashing out at a low multiplier, leaving money on the table. Conversely, the fear of missing out can lead to waiting too long and crashing before reaching a profitable payout. Developing emotional control and maintaining a rational mindset are essential skills for success in the crash game. Recognize your own tendencies – are you prone to impulsiveness or excessive caution? – and adjust your strategy accordingly. Practicing mindfulness and taking regular breaks can also help you stay grounded and avoid getting caught up in the excitement of the game. Remember, the goal is not to hit the biggest possible multiplier every time, but to consistently make profitable decisions over the long term.
